Gifts abound from Apple

The presence of Salvation Army bell ringers tells us the time of year. Since more gift ideas are in order, why not start with Apple’s IMac desktop computers? Apple’s desktops, the new, sleek, shiny ones, are excellent gifts. I’ve used the next-latest version at home, but the more recent versions, out several months without reports of major hassles, are slimmer, more powerful, and feature a very nice, compact keyboard and the Apple mouse.

Starting at $1,199 for a 20-inch display-sized model, 1 gigabyte of RAM and a 250 GB hard-disk drive, even the “low-end” model might be all some users need. And, of course, the IMac now comes with the Mac OS X Leopard operating system, and is built on an Intel Corp. processor. That means you can, if you want or need to, run Microsoft’s Windows using Apple’s Boot Camp software. In other words, it’s like getting two computers for the price of one.

If you must get a Windows-based PC, there are some excellent models from Hewlett-Packard Co. at area stores such as Costco. The models I’ve seen tend toward having nice-sized screens (19- and 20-inch LCD displays) included in the package. Frankly, HP is my preferred brand for desktop computers these days. Dell, after more than a year of promises, hasn’t delivered anything to review. The sound of music has rarely been easier to attain, either on your computer or via Apple’s superpopular IPod.

Two products from Bose Corp. will come in handy. The Bose Computer MusicMonitor speakers, for example, will connect to either an IPod’s headphone jack or a computer’s sound output jack. The music you will hear is nothing short of astonishing. The sound, as mentioned here not too long ago, is full and vibrant. I’m thrilled with it. Equally impressive, and connectable to both a computer and an IPod, is the Bose SoundDock, a portable speaker system that boasts a rechargeable lithium-ion battery.
